Turn2us
Turn2us is a UK poverty charity that offers practical information and support to people facing financial insecurity. We work alongside people who have experienced not having enough money to live on, to develop tools and services that help people cope with life-changing events, which we know can quickly turn into a financial crisis. We offer support and information through our benefits calculator, grants search tool, helpline and direct financial assistance through a range of specific grant funds.
Cost-of-living crisis

More people than ever are facing huge shortfalls in their incomes as the cost-of-living tightens it grip on the nation. Parents are forced to skip meals just to feed their children or sit in the dark to limit their energy use, simply to get by. Sadly, we anticipate that the number of people in need of support from Turn2us services could skyrocket throughout the winter.
